Overview of the Polish Driver's License
In Poland, the motorist's license is not only an identification document but also a legal requirement for running a vehicle. The license is released in a standardized format constant with European Union regulations, guaranteeing recognition across member states.

International Recognition
A Polish motorist's license is acknowledged in all European Union countries, thanks to the EU's efforts to standardize motorist documents. However, if you prepare to drive in non-EU nations, it's a good idea to check if an International Driving Permit (IDP) is required or suggested.
